Transaction 1a10585ea21c342319889080bcc4f2f4e077750c9a92b2421a85df61a8b87589
1 Input
1 Output
-
1a10585ea21c342319889080bcc4f2f4e077750c9a92b2421a85df61a8b87589:0
- value
- 143968
- script pubkey
- OP_0 OP_PUSHBYTES_20 8e27af77600610c5f75babc71301828f0f87bf89
- address
- bc1q3cn67amqqcgvta6m40r3xqvz3u8c00ufpukryt